App Cleaner & Uninstaller is a software application for macOS. It was developed by Nektony LLC[1], a software company based in Odesa, Ukraine. App Cleaner & Uninstaller is used to remove applications on Apple Mac computers with no remains left on the system. In 2023 it won the Red Dot Award in the Design & Communication category.[2]
Features
App Cleaner & Uninstaller[3] offers a variety of tools used to clean up a Mac from remaining files, manage extensions, and optimize performance. It determines leftovers of previously removed programs.
- Uninstalling programs
- Managing extensions
- Managing startup programs
- Removing remaining files
- Selecting extensions to open specific files by default
History
- 2015 - was launched in the App Store
- 2018 - left the App Store and started distribution on the developer’s website
- 2021 - Added support for eight languages: English, German, French, Ukrainian, Russian, Chinese, Japanese[4]
- 2022 - major update with a total redesign[5]
- 2023 - getting the Red Dot Award in the Design & Communications category.[6]
